one hundred sixty-nine million, nine hundred ninety-five thousand, one hundred seventy-five
货币$169995175 英文: one hundred sixty-nine million, nine hundred ninety-five thousand, one hundred seventy-five US Dollars.
价格: 169995175.00
159995175 | 179995175